| Career Roles | Key Responsibilities |
|---|---|
| Cyber Security Analyst | Monitor and analyze security incidents, respond to incidents, and implement security measures. |
| Incident Response Coordinator | Coordinate incident response activities, communicate with stakeholders, and ensure timely resolution of incidents. |
| Security Operations Center (SOC) Analyst | Monitor security events, investigate alerts, and escalate incidents as needed. |
| Cyber Security Incident Manager | Manage cyber security incidents, develop incident response plans, and lead incident response teams. |
| Forensic Analyst | Conduct digital forensics investigations, analyze evidence, and report findings. |
